How Proper Water Damage Documentation Works
Cutting corners on documentation means cutting corners on your claim and the quality of your restoration. Our approach is meticulous, focusing on the science of drying and structural integrity. We use industry-leading tools to measure moisture content in materials like drywall, wood, and insulation, ensuring we identify the full scope of the problem, even in hidden areas. This scientific method is crucial for preventing long-term issues like mold growth and structural compromise. We believe in providing thorough, evidence-based reports.
Initial Assessment and Moisture Mapping
Upon arrival, our technicians conduct a rapid assessment of the visible water damage. We then deploy specialized equipment like infrared cameras and moisture meters to create a detailed map of where moisture has penetrated. This process typ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the size of the affected area, and gives us a clear picture of the hidden water damage.
Water Source Identification and Containment
Pinpointing the exact source of the water intrusion is our next priority. Whether it’s a burst pipe, a roof leak, or appliance failure, we identify it and advise on immediate steps to stop further damage. We then establish containment zones using barriers to prevent cross-contamination and control the drying environment. This critical step ensures that restoration efforts are focused.
Detailed Photographic and Video Evidence
Every aspect of the damage is documented with high-resolution photography and video. This includes close-ups of stained materials, moisture meter readings, and the overall scope of the affected areas. This visual record is invaluable for insurance adjusters and provides you with a clear understanding of the situation.
Material Moisture Content Readings
We use calibrated moisture meters to take readings from various building materials, including wood framing, drywall, and flooring. These readings are meticulously recorded and logged in our reports, showing the exact moisture levels compared to acceptable standards. This objective data is essential for verifying the extent of moisture intrusion.
Final Report Generation
Once all data is collected, we compile a comprehensive report. This document includes all photographic evidence, moisture readings, a description of the damage, the identified source, and recommended remediation steps. This detailed report is your official record of the damage and is ready for your review and submission.

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Documentation Services
Ignoring early warning signs of water damage can lead to far more extensive and costly repairs down the line. Recognizing these indicators is the first step toward protecting your home. Our team is skilled at identifying and documenting even the most subtle signs of moisture problems.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ent damp, musty smell, especially in enclosed spaces like closets or basements,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or often signals the beginning of mold or mildew growth, which thrives in damp environments. It’s a clear sign you need professional moisture investigation.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ains on ceilings, walls, or floors are obvious signs of a leak. These marks indicate that water has saturated the material and is likely continuing to spread behind surfaces. These stains are direct evidence of water intrusion points.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
When paint or wallpaper begins to peel, bubble, or blister, it’s often because moisture is trapped behind it, loosening the adhesive. This is a visual cue that the underlying structure is absorbing water. You should get immediate structural inspection.
Warped or Sagging Floors and Ceilings
Wood floors that cup, warp, or buckle, or ceilings that sag, are serious indicators of prolonged water exposure. The structural integrity of these materials is compromised when they become oversaturated. This requires urgent structural assessment.
Increased Humidity Levels
If your home feels unusually humid, sticky, or damp, even with air conditioning running, it could be due to an undetected water source. High humidity can foster mold growth and create an uncomfortable living environment. Monitoring your indoor humidity levels is key.
Sounds of Dripping or Running Water
Hearing faint dripping sounds when no faucets are running, or the sound of water where it shouldn’t be, means a leak is likely active. These auditory clues can help pinpoint problem areas that might otherwise go unnoticed. Don’t ignore these audible leak indicators.
Water Damage Documentation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Identifying a small, visible ceiling stain from a recent minor leak. | Yes | No | You can likely see and assess the extent of this damage yourself. |
| Measuring surface moisture on visible flooring after a spill. | Yes | No | A simple home moisture meter can give you a basic reading. |
| Detecting a musty smell in a closed closet. | Maybe | Yes | While you can smell it, a pro can find the hidden source and extent of moisture. |
| Documenting water damage for an insurance claim. | No | Yes | Professionals use specialized equipment and standardized reporting for accurate claims. |
| Determining moisture content within walls or subflooring. | No | Yes | Requires infrared cameras and calibrated meters that homeowners typically don’t have. |
| Assessing potential structural damage from a slow, long-term leak. | No | Yes | Requires expert evaluation to understand the full impact on your home’s integrity. |

Common Questions About Water Damage Documentation Services
What is the first step in documenting water damage?
The very first step is to safely assess the situation and identify the source of the water. Our team prioritizes your safety and will immediately work to stop the flow of water if possible. We then begin the process of documenting the visible damage and using specialized tools to map out the extent of moisture intrusion.
How long does water damage documentation take?
The time required for documentation can vary significantly. A simple case might take a few hours, while extensive damage to a larger property could take a day or more. Our goal is to be thorough, not rushed, ensuring we capture all necessary details for an accurate record of the moisture problem.
Will my insurance cover water damage documentation services?
Often, yes. Insurance policies typically cover the costs associated with assessing and documenting damage to establish the scope of the claim. Our detailed reports are designed to meet insurance requirements, providing them with the necessary information to process your claim efficiently. We help you present a clear insurance claim.
What equipment do you use for water damage documentation?
We utilize a range of advanced tools, including infrared cameras to detect temperature differences caused by moisture, calibrated moisture meters for accurate readings in various materials, and high-resolution cameras for detailed photographic and video evidence. This equipment allows us to provide an objective measurement of damage.
Can I prevent water damage from happening in the first place?
While not all water damage is preventable, regular maintenance can significantly reduce risks. This includes inspecting roofs and plumbing, ensuring proper drainage around your foundation, and promptly addressing any small leaks.
